Condition for Flotation

An object will float if the buoyancy force exerted on it by the fluid balances its weight, i.e. if FB=mg F B = mg . ... When the buoyant force equals one ton, it will sink no further. When any boat displaces a weight of water equal to its own weight, it floats.

Explanation:

an object has a density less than the density of water, it floats. Like, leaf of a plant floats on the water because the density of leaf is less than the density of water. A stone thrown in water sinks because the density of stone is more than the density of water
